Gutter Waterproofing in Longmont, CO
Gutter waterproofing services focus on protecting the foundation and interior of a property by preventing water intrusion through the gutter system. This service typically involves sealing and waterproofing areas where gutters connect to the roofline, addressing leaks, and ensuring proper drainage to avoid water damage. Projects may include applying waterproof coatings, installing seamless gutter systems, or adding protective barriers around vulnerable joints and seams. Homeowners interested in gutter waterproofing should understand the specific areas that need treatment, the types of waterproofing materials used, and how the service can help prevent issues like basement flooding, mold growth, or structural deterioration.

Gutter Waterproofing Questions
What is gutter waterproofing? Gutter waterproofing involves sealing and protecting gutters to prevent leaks and water damage around the property.
Why is gutter waterproofing important? It helps prevent water infiltration that can cause foundation issues, mold growth, and structural damage.
What types of projects benefit from gutter waterproofing? Homeowners with aging or damaged gutters, properties in heavy rainfall areas, or those experiencing leaks may find waterproofing beneficial.
How does gutter waterproofing work? It typically involves applying sealants, coatings, or installing liners to keep water contained within the gutter system.
